Answer:
y = 1/8(x -2)^2 -1
Step-by-step explanation:
The vertex form of the equation of a parabola can be written as ...
y = (1/(4p))(x -h)^2 +k
for vertex (h, k) and vertex-to-directrix distance p. Here, the vertex has a y-value of -1, and the directrix has a y-value of -3, so the distance between them is -1 -(-3) = 2, and the desired equation with vertex (2, -1) is ...
y = 1/8(x -2)^2 -1
